Palm Harbor University has won three straight games at home, while Timber Creek has won three straight on the road, but those streaks won't matter much on Monday. The Palm Harbor University Hurricanes will host the Timber Creek Wolves at 1:00 p.m. The two teams each escaped with close wins against their previous opponents.
Palm Harbor University is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Wednesday. They narrowly escaped with a win as the squad sidled past Riverview 3-2. Given the Hurricanes' advantage in MaxPreps' Florida soccer rankings (they are ranked eighth, while the Sharks are ranked 103rd),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Palm Harbor University hit Riverview with a three-pronged attack, as the team got scores from Hubert Kumik, Nicholas Malak, and Mohamed Tejeddine.
Meanwhile, Timber Creek kept a clean sheet against West Orange on Wednesday. They beat the Warriors by a goal, winning 1-0. That's two games straight that Wolves have won by just one goal.
Timber Creek has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 13 of their last 14 games, which provided a nice bump to their 16-3 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they scored 47 goals over those 14 matchups. As for Palm Harbor University, their victory bumped their record up to 19-1.
